全文搜索
标题搜索
全部时间
1小时内
1天内
1周内
1个月内
默认排序
按时间排序
为您找到相关结果461,274个

Java monitor机制使用方法解析_java_脚本之家

monitor在java中的实现 临界区的圈定 被synchronized关键字修饰的方法,代码块,就是monitor机制的临界区 monitor object 在上述synchronized关键字被使用时,往往需要指定一个对象与之关联,例如synchronized(this),总之,synchronized需要管理一个对象,这个对象就是monitor object。 monitor机制中,monitor 我不检测题充当着维护m...
www.jb51.net/article/1711...htm 2025-5-4

C#使用Monitor类实现线程同步_C#教程_脚本之家

Monitor.Enter(obj); //代码段 Monitor.Exit(obj); Monitor的常用属性和方法: Enter(Object) 在指定对象上获取排他锁。 Exit(Object) 释放指定对象上的排他锁。 Pulse 通知等待队列中的线程锁定对象状态的更改。 PulseAll 通知所有的等待线程对象状态的更改。 TryEnter(Object) 试图获取指定对象的排他锁。 TryEnte...
www.jb51.net/article/2451...htm 2025-5-17

synchronized背后的monitor锁实现详解_java_脚本之家

所以首先我们来看下获取和释放 monitor 锁的时机,每个 Java 对象都可以用作一个实现同步的锁,这个锁也被称为内置锁或 monitor 锁,获得 monitor 锁的唯一途径就是进入由这个锁保护的同步代码块或同步方法,线程在进入被 synchronized 保护的代码块之前,会自动获取锁,并且无论是正常路径退出,还是通过抛出异常退出,在退...
www.jb51.net/article/2619...htm 2025-5-11

C#中Monitor对象与Lock关键字的区别分析_C#教程_脚本之家

Monitor.Exit(obj); } 3.锁定的对象应该声明为private static object obj = new object();尽量别用公共变量和字符串、this、值类型。 Monitor和Lock的区别 1.Lock是Monitor的语法糖。 2.Lock只能针对引用类型加锁。 3.Monitor能够对值类型进行加锁,实质上是Monitor.Enter(object)时对值类型装箱。 4.Monitor还有...
www.jb51.net/article/390...htm 2025-4-25

C#中的lock、Monitor、Mutex学习笔记_C#教程_脚本之家

lock是对Monitor的Enter和Exit的一个封装,因此Monitor类的Enter()和Exit()方法的组合使用可以用lock关键字替代。 Monitor类除了具有lock的功能外,还有以下功能: TryEnter()解决长期死等的问题,如果一个并发经常发生,并且持续时间很长,使用TryEnter,可以有效防止死锁或者长时间 的等待。
www.jb51.net/article/601...htm 2025-5-8

详谈锁和监视器之间的区别_Java并发_java_脚本之家

在面试中你可能遇到过这样的问题:锁(lock)和监视器(monitor)有什么区别? 嗯,要回答这个问题,你必须深入理解Java的多线程底层是如何工作的。 简短的答案是,锁为实现监视器提供必要的支持。详细答案如下。 锁(lock) 逻辑上锁是对象内存堆中头部的一部分数据。JVM中的每个对象都有一个锁(或互斥锁),任何程序都可以...
www.jb51.net/article/1164...htm 2025-5-5

深入了解Java中Synchronized关键字的实现原理_java_脚本之家

在并发编程中,监视器(Monitor)是Java虚拟机(JVM)的内置同步机制,旨在实现线程之间的互斥访问和协调。每个Java对象都有一个与之关联的Monitor。这个Monitor的实现是在JVM的内部完成的,它采用了一些底层的同步原语,用以实现线程间的等待和唤醒机制,这也是为什么等待(wait)和通知(notify)方法是属于Object类的原因。这两个...
www.jb51.net/program/288119d...htm 2025-5-18

monitor.exe是什么进程 有什么作用 monitor进程查询_系统进程_操作系统...

monitor.exe是Microsoft服务器操作系统硬件监视服务相关程序。 出品者:Microsoft Corp. 属于:Microsoft Windows Server Suites 系统进程:Yes 后台程序:Yes 网络相关:No 常见错误:N/A 内存使用:N/A 安全等级 (0-5): 0 间谍软件:No 广告软件:No 病毒:No ...
www.jb51.net/os/712...html 2025-4-27

Redis Monitor 命令 - Redis - 菜鸟学堂-脚本之家

Redis Monitor 命令用于实时打印出 Redis 服务器接收到的命令,调试用。语法redis Monitor 命令基本语法如下:redis 127.0.0.1:6379> MONITOR可用版本>= 1.0.0返回值总是返回 OK 。实例redis 127.0.0.1:6379> MONITOR OK 1410855382.370791 [0 127.0.0.1:60581] "info"...
edu.jb51.net/redis/redis-serv...moni... 2025-4-5

详解appium自动化测试工具(monitor、uiautomatorviewer)_python_脚 ...

1、monitor.bat(获取app的package&activity) 该文件位于your_andriod_sdk_path\tools下面。 该工具可以帮我们找到android控件的content-description,为以后的find_element_by_accessibility_id定位方法做参数使用。 2、uiautomatorviewer.bat(获取app的package和控件属性) ...
www.jb51.net/article/2048...htm 2025-5-12